Air France Expands Caribbean Connectivity with New Route to Panama City
In a significant move to enhance its network in the Caribbean, Air France has announced the launch of a new direct flight route connecting Guadeloupe to Panama City. This strategic expansion aims to bolster tourism and business travel between the two regions, offering passengers greater access to Central America and beyond. Set to commence operations in the coming months, the route underscores Air France’s commitment to developing its Caribbean offerings, catering to the increasing demand for travel options in this vibrant area. With this latest addition, travelers can look forward to more seamless journeys and opportunities for exploration within the diverse landscapes of Panama and the Caribbean.

Travel Recommendations: Maximizing Your Journey Between the Caribbean and Central America
The newly announced route by Air France connecting Guadeloupe and Panama City opens up a world of opportunities for travelers eager to explore the vibrant cultures and stunning landscapes of both regions. Direct flights mean less time spent in transit and more time for adventure. For those seeking to experience the beauty of the Caribbean, Guadeloupe offers breathtaking beaches, lush rainforests, and a rich Creole heritage. Just a short flight away, Panama City dazzles with its mix of modern architecture and colonial charm, alongside the pristine biodiversity of its surrounding rainforest ecosystems.
Travelers can maximize their journey by taking advantage of various activities available in both destinations. Consider these highlights:
- Guadeloupe: Snorkeling in the crystal-clear waters of the Pointe des Châteaux, hiking in the Grande Soufrière volcano, or indulging in local Creole cuisine at charming seaside restaurants.
- Panama City: Exploring the historic Casco Viejo district, visiting the Panama Canal, or taking a day trip to the stunning San Blas Islands for a glimpse into indigenous culture.
To aid travelers in planning their itineraries, the table below outlines the average flight duration and frequency for this new route:
| Route | Average Flight Duration | Frequency |
|---|---|---|
| Guadeloupe to Panama City | 3 hours 15 minutes | Four times a week |
